Delete your account & data
This page explains how to permanently delete your CalmPath account and the data associated with
it, what gets removed, and what we retain.
Option 1 — Delete it in the app (fastest)
- Open CalmPath and sign in.
- Go to Profile → Settings → Delete account.
- Confirm you understand it can't be undone, then re-enter your password.
Your account and data are deleted immediately upon confirmation.

What is deleted
- Your account and profile (email, display name)
- All chat conversations with Calm
- Your mood check-ins and history
- Your journal entries
- Your wellness insights
- Your notification preferences and subscription record
What is retained
-
Anonymized crisis-safety records — for everyone's safety we keep a record that
a safety event occurred (severity and time only, with no link back to you and no
message content).
-
Anonymized, aggregated usage analytics — de-identified event counts, never any
message, journal, or mood-note content.
We may also retain limited records where required by law. We never keep the content of your
conversations, journal, or mood notes after deletion.
Active subscription? Deleting your CalmPath account does
not
cancel a Google Play (or App Store) subscription. Cancel it first in your store account:
